The video discusses the current state of the German economy, highlighting the GDP figures and the ongoing recovery. It addresses labor market challenges, including job cuts and the prevalence of short-term work. The discussion extends to the short-term work scheme, its benefits, and potential drawbacks. The video also covers the role of the ECB and fiscal stimulus in supporting the economy, emphasizing the need for effective implementation of fiscal policies. Finally, it explores the risks associated with insolvency and the potential for creating zombie companies.
